Chinki has gone through yet another successful day. 

She has answered all questions asked at school, got back from school and finished her homework. 

She has had her dinner on time and set timetable for the next day, kept her uniform pressed and shoes polished.

That's what a good day in the life of the little girl in class 4 sounds like. But today had an extra challenge for Chinki.

She had been watching the advertisement of a new horror show that was about to start. Although she hated horror shows, she was determined to watch it.

This was a result of the little monster in her head. She spent a lot of time talking to herself in her mind. People outside barely knew what she was upto. 

She was a shy introvert girl, scared to be judged and barely opened up. Only the little monster knew her fears, her strengths, her secrets and her problems.

Little monster had dared her to do this. Chinki had to watch half an hour of horror show all alone and she could not mute the show in between.

The clock struck 9 times to indicate the start of the show. She slowly walked outside the room towards the drawing room, squeezing her blanket in both hands. She picked the remote and changed the channel.

'Aaaaa Aaaaa...' The show began. She looked around but there was no one. She turned to the TV to see an old worn clock in front of an old worn haveli... It had a huge lawn that looked spooky in the light of the single lamppost located far away..

Chinki put the blanket on her head and heard footsteps approaching a girl seated on a bench near a huge tree. She covered her face to avoid being scared and just then heard a scream.

Chinki squeezed her eyes and tried to close her ears that were already holding the blanket. She dint move for five minutes and opened her eyes and took off the blanket only when she heard the sparrows chirping...

A servant was serving tea to a man seated in a lawn. He seemed disturbed and his hsbds shook as he placed the tea cup and tray of biscuits on the table. "Kya hua kaka?" asked the man. 

"Saahab, gao se chitthi aayi hai, ma beemar hai. Mujhe Jaana padega" he said in a shaky voice. 

"Arey, toh isme jhijhak kaisi?, ye lijiye kuch paise, jaiye" came the reply.

The servant took the money, turned and gave a wicked side smile looking at the camera. 'This fellow is crooked' Chinki told to little monster.

It was night again. 'How does night fall so soon?' she asked little monster. She gripped her blanket again trying to cover her eyes that stared at the TV.

This time the girl was sitting in the same place and was whispering something. The whispers grew louder as footsteps approached the bench and slash.... There was a splash of blood on the tree...

Chinki closed her eyes again and waited for the morning scene. Just then, she felt a hand on her shoulder and she screamed. "Don't watch it if you get scared" her father said. 

He switched the TV off and told her to go and sleep. She quietly got up wondering what had happened and whose blood it was on the tree.....
